The Shreds are powerful rock trio from the foothills of the Sierra Mountains with a vast stylistic blend of grunge, folk and garage rock. From acoustic melodies to intense guitar jams, The Shreds’ debut CD Stranger, creates a rich musical world, both subtle and explosive. The Shreds have won both the 2009 John Lennon Bus Battle for the Bus and the 2008 Sacramento News & Reviews Jammies competition - and they are nominees for a 2009 Sammies Award. Stranger, was produced by five-time Academy Award nominee sound editor, Michael Herbick & Sacramento's David Houston. “The Shreds explode like a fire on a summer night, embracing the raw honesty of rock and roll poets both alive and dead.
